[timeout:300][out:json];
(
node(around:1000,50.09770,8.54785)[building][~"^(addr:housenumber|.*name.*)$"~".",i];
way(around:1000,50.09770,8.54785)[building][~"^(addr:housenumber|.*name.*)$"~".",i];
rel(around:1000,50.09770,8.54785)[building][~"^(addr:housenumber|.*name.*)$"~".",i];
node(around:1000,50.09770,8.54785)[harbour][~"^(addr:housenumber|.*name.*)$"~".",i];
way(around:1000,50.09770,8.54785)[harbour][~"^(addr:housenumber|.*name.*)$"~".",i];
rel(around:1000,50.09770,8.54785)[harbour][~"^(addr:housenumber|.*name.*)$"~".",i];
node(around:1000,50.09770,8.54785)[subject][~"^(addr:housenumber|.*name.*)$"~".",i];
way(around:1000,50.09770,8.54785)[subject][~"^(addr:housenumber|.*name.*)$"~".",i];
rel(around:1000,50.09770,8.54785)[subject][~"^(addr:housenumber|.*name.*)$"~".",i];
node(around:1000,50.09770,8.54785)[building=yes][~"^(addr:housenumber|.*name.*)$"~".",i];
way(around:1000,50.09770,8.54785)[building=yes][~"^(addr:housenumber|.*name.*)$"~".",i];
rel(around:1000,50.09770,8.54785)[building=yes][~"^(addr:housenumber|.*name.*)$"~".",i];
node(around:1000,50.09770,8.54785)[industrial=port][~"^(addr:housenumber|.*name.*)$"~".",i];
way(around:1000,50.09770,8.54785)[industrial=port][~"^(addr:housenumber|.*name.*)$"~".",i];
rel(around:1000,50.09770,8.54785)[industrial=port][~"^(addr:housenumber|.*name.*)$"~".",i];
node(around:1000,50.09770,8.54785)[leisure=park][name];
way(around:1000,50.09770,8.54785)[leisure=park][name];
rel(around:1000,50.09770,8.54785)[leisure=park][name];
node(around:1000,50.09770,8.54785)[natural=bay][name];
way(around:1000,50.09770,8.54785)[natural=bay][name];
rel(around:1000,50.09770,8.54785)[natural=bay][name];
node(around:1000,50.09770,8.54785)[natural=water][name];
way(around:1000,50.09770,8.54785)[natural=water][name];
rel(around:1000,50.09770,8.54785)[natural=water][name];
node(around:1000,50.09770,8.54785)["public_transport"="platform"][~"^(addr:housenumber|.*name.*)$"~".",i];
way(around:1000,50.09770,8.54785)["public_transport"="platform"][~"^(addr:housenumber|.*name.*)$"~".",i];
rel(around:1000,50.09770,8.54785)["public_transport"="platform"][~"^(addr:housenumber|.*name.*)$"~".",i];
node(around:1000,50.09770,8.54785)["public_transport"="station"][~"^(addr:housenumber|.*name.*)$"~".",i];
way(around:1000,50.09770,8.54785)["public_transport"="station"][~"^(addr:housenumber|.*name.*)$"~".",i];
rel(around:1000,50.09770,8.54785)["public_transport"="station"][~"^(addr:housenumber|.*name.*)$"~".",i];
node(around:1000,50.09770,8.54785)["public_transport"="stop_position"][~"^(addr:housenumber|.*name.*)$"~".",i];
way(around:1000,50.09770,8.54785)["public_transport"="stop_position"][~"^(addr:housenumber|.*name.*)$"~".",i];
rel(around:1000,50.09770,8.54785)["public_transport"="stop_position"][~"^(addr:housenumber|.*name.*)$"~".",i];
node(around:1000,50.09770,8.54785)["seamark:type"="harbour"][~"^(addr:housenumber|.*name.*)$"~".",i];
way(around:1000,50.09770,8.54785)["seamark:type"="harbour"][~"^(addr:housenumber|.*name.*)$"~".",i];
rel(around:1000,50.09770,8.54785)["seamark:type"="harbour"][~"^(addr:housenumber|.*name.*)$"~".",i];
);
out center tags;
Der Höchster Hafen war ein städtischer Binnenhafen im Frankfurter Stadtteil Höchst. Die Anfänge des ursprünglich in der Niddamündung und später am Main gelegenen Hafens reichen bis in die römische Zeit des späten ersten Jahrhunderts zurück. Der Höchster Mainhafen bestand bis 1982. Seit 2006 ist der ehemalige Hafen eine Uferpromenade mit Grünanlagen und Biergarten.
no matches found
| station (Q12819564) | public_transport=station |
| body of water (Q15324) | natural=water |
| park (Q22698) | leisure=park |
| harbor (Q283202) | seamark:type=harbour |
| recreation area (Q338112) | leisure=recreation_ground, landuse=recreation_ground |
| bay (Q39594) | natural=bay |
| building (Q41176) | building=yes |
| public transport stop (Q548662) | public_transport=stop_position, public_transport=platform |
| inland port (Q863915) | industrial=port |